Surah An-Nas (in Arabic ٱلنَّاس) is the 114th chapter (surah) of the Islamic holy book Quran. It has 6 verses and it is Makki Surah. And the name of this surah means “Mankind” in English. In this surah, Allah (God) is described as the protector of the believers, and it is declared that He alone is worthy of worship. In this surah, the importance of seeking refuge with Allah from the evil of Satan is also highlighted.

Surah An-Nas in Arabic

بِسۡمِ ٱللَّهِ ٱلرَّحۡمَٰنِ ٱلرَّحِيمِ
قُلۡ أَعُوذُ بِرَبِّ ٱلنَّاسِ
مَلِكِ ٱلنَّاسِ
إِلَٰهِ ٱلنَّاسِ
مِن شَرِّ ٱلۡوَسۡوَاسِ ٱلۡخَنَّاسِ
ٱلَّذِي يُوَسۡوِسُ فِي صُدُورِ ٱلنَّاسِ
مِنَ ٱلۡجِنَّةِ وَٱلنَّاسِ
Surah An-Nas in Transliteration

Bismillah hir rahman nir raheem
Qul a’oozu bi-rabbin naas
Malikin-naas
Ilaahin-naas
Min sharril waswaasil khan-naas
Allazee yuwaswisu fee sudoorin-naas
Minal jinnati wan-naas
Surah An-Nas Translation in English

In the name of Allah, the Entirely Merciful, the Especially Merciful.
Say, “I seek refuge in the Lord of mankind,
The Sovereign of mankind.
The God of mankind,
From the evil of the retreating whisperer –
Who whispers [evil] into the breasts of mankind –
From among the jinn and mankind.”
Benefits of surah An-Nas

It is worth noting that the benefits of reciting Surah al-Nas or any other surah of the Quran are derived from believing in its teachings and trying to live according to them, rather than just reciting them.
